Selling my 1991 C4. Car is a late build with engine # M07125, which is said to have newer engine w/ head gaskets installed from the factory. The car is guards red w/ black interior.
Factory Option Codes:
C02 U.S. Standard/Emissions
P01 Comfort Package
340 Heated Seat Right
139 Heated Seat Left
030 Special Chassis Rigidly Tuned
I am the third owner and have owned it for a little over a year. Have all records from 1999, when the second owner purchased the car, cataloged by date in a binder. Clean Carfax.
It currently has 65k mi on it. Recently had a full 60k service w/ valve adjustment where I also had the main oil lines replaced (feed and return) and the camshaft seal housing to address some leaks.
